South african airways (saa) is seeking quotations from qualified service providers to deliver enterprise-grade penetration testing services (both internal and external) along with continuous active exploit monitoring capabilities. The successful bidder will be responsible for identifying vulnerabilities, simulating real-world attacks, and providing actionable intelligence to strengthen saa's cybersecurity posture across a minimum of 2,200 user endpoints. This tender is specifically targeted at cybersecurity firms with proven experience in financial and aviation sectors, with a minimum of 8 years relevant experience.
Bidders must have a minimum of 8 years combined professional experience in penetration testing and active watch services within financial and aviation industries, supported by purchase orders and contracts as evidence. The delivery team must include at least 5 OSCP-certified security professionals with additional certifications such as CREST, CEH, GPEN, or equivalent. A technical functionality threshold of 75% must be achieved; bidders who fail to meet this will be disqualified from further evaluation. Bidders must demonstrate compliance with internationally recognised cybersecurity standards (ISO/IEC 27001 or NIST Cybersecurity Framework) and certifications such as OSSTMM, OWASP Testing Guide, or PTES. Submissions must include all mandatory returnable documents (SAA Vendor Document, SBD 4, General Conditions of Contract) and a valid Tax Clearance Certificate. Pricing must be submitted exclusive of VAT, be firm (fixed), and broken down by individual components. Preference points (20 points) are allocated for B-BBEE Level 1 or 2 (10 points) and 30%+ Black Women Ownership (10 points).

Pricing Schedule
Source: Annexure 3 - SAA General conditions of contract.pdf (TENDER)If a price other than an all-inclusive delivered price is required, it will be specified in the SCC. Prices charged must not vary from bid prices except as authorized in the SCC or bid validity extension.
Financial Requirements
Source: Annexure 3 - SAA General conditions of contract.pdf (TENDER)Prices must not vary from the bid price except as authorized in the SCC or bid validity extension. Payment terms are specified in the SCC. Payments are made in Rand, within 30 days of invoice submission, upon fulfillment of contract obligations.
Compliance Requirements
Source: Annexure 3 - SAA General conditions of contract.pdf (TENDER)A tax clearance certificate issued by SARS is required prior to award. No contract will be concluded with bidders whose tax matters are not in order. The National Industrial Participation (NIP) Programme applies if subject to NIP obligation. Collusive bidding is prohibited and may lead to restriction from public sector business.
